Understanding Tricare Pharmacy Benefits

Before we dive into how to use the Tricare Formulary Search Tool, let's first review some basics of the Tricare pharmacy program.

Tricare offers several pharmacy options, including military treatment facility (MTF) pharmacies, Tricare retail network pharmacies, Tricare Mail Order Pharmacy, and Tricare specialty pharmacies. Depending on your location, medical needs, and prescription medications, you may use one or more of these pharmacy options.

Tricare pharmacy benefits are divided into three tiers, each with different copayments:

  • Tier 1: Generic prescription medications with the lowest copayments.
  • Tier 2: Brand-name prescription medications with higher copayments than Tier 1.
  • Tier 3: Non-formulary prescription medications with the highest copayments.

To receive Tricare prescription coverage, you must have a valid prescription from a licensed healthcare provider. You may also need to meet certain criteria for coverage, such as prior authorization or medical necessity.

Step 1: Access the Tool

The Tricare Formulary Search Tool is available on the Tricare website. To access the tool, go to www.tricare.mil/CoveredServices/Pharmacy/FormularySearch and select your Tricare plan from the dropdown menu.

Step 2: Search for Your Medication

Once you access the tool, you can search for your medication by entering its name or the first few letters of its name in the search bar. You can also browse the formulary by clicking on the alphabet letters or drug categories listed on the tool.

Step 3: Review Medication Coverage and Information

Once you find your medication, you can see its coverage status, which tier it falls under, and any applicable copayments. You can also see any restrictions or limitations on the medication, such as quantity limits or prior authorization requirements.

If your medication is not listed in the formulary, it may not be covered under the Tricare pharmacy program. However, you can work with your healthcare provider to find alternative medication options that are covered by Tricare.

Step 4: Locate a Tricare Network Pharmacy

Once you know which medication you need, you can locate a Tricare network pharmacy that carries it. Tricare retail network pharmacies are the most common pharmacy option, and there are over 58,000 participating pharmacies nationwide.

 : Tricare retired reserve for survivors

To find a Tricare network pharmacy near you, go to the Tricare website and use the Find a Doctor, Hospital or Pharmacy tool. You can search for pharmacies by location, pharmacy name, or pharmacy type. You can also filter your search results by specific pharmacy services, such as 24-hour pharmacies or pharmacies with drive-thru services.

If you prefer to have your medications delivered directly to your door, you may consider using the Tricare Mail Order Pharmacy. This option allows you to order up to a 90-day supply of your medication and have it delivered to your home. You can also order refills online, by phone, or by mail.
